WebEryngium zabelii 'Big Blue' is a spectacular performer with a columnar habit and spiky, 4″ bright violet-blue flowers. Superb in the garden with Echinacea, Liatris, and Phlox. An excellent cut flower, too. PP 20,636This highly distinctive genus offers shapes and shades unlike anything else, and is valued for that reason.
